Osteoarthritis Chronic Care Program
Eligibility: Patients on the waiting list for elective total hip or knee replacement. Referrals from Rheumatologists, General Practitioners and Orthopaedic Surgeons for conservative management also accepted.
Multidisciplinary Team includes: Rheumatologist, Physiotherapist, Dietitian and Clinical Psychologist.
Osteoporosis Refracture Prevention Program
Our service aims to provide a comprehensive assessment to identify, assess and treat people over 50 years of age who have sustained a minimal trauma fracture.
Our multidisciplinary team includes a Rheumatologist, Fracture Liaison Coordinator, Dietitian, Physiotherapist and Clinical Psychologist.
We also perform Dual Energy X-ray Absorptiometry (DXA) which is the gold standard for the diagnosis of osteoporosis. This safe and painless technique is often referred to as bone densitometry.
Bone Mineral Density (BMD) DXA Scans
A valid GP referral is required.
All Medicare card-holders who are eligible for a bone density scan will be bulk-billed.
Your referring doctor should be able to inform you if you fulfil Medicare criteria for a scan. We will check your eligibility at your appointment.
Fees may apply in cases where scans are requested outside the medicare criteria. Please call us if you are unsure.
